:dateline:The Uttar Pradesh police have booked 55 Sikhs for taking out religious procession in commemoration of the martyrdom of Chaar Sahibzaade from Kiratpur Gurdwara in Uttar Pradesh�s Pilibhit district on December 29. The booked Sikhs have been accused of violating the section 144 of Cr.P.C which was imposed by the Yogi Adityanath led Uttar Pradesh government to suppress protests against CAA and proposed NRC.


It is learnt that the police also seized a vehicle with Nishan Sahib which was a part of this religious procession. Initial reports reveal that the police have registered an FIR under section 188 of IPC (disobedience to order duly promulgated by public servant) in which names of five Sikhs have been included while the other 50 have been depicted as unidentified.
Station House Officer (SHO) Sanjeev Kumar Upadhaya, has claimed that the Sikhs were taking out religious procession without permission.
However, the villagers have informed that they had sought permission from sub-divisional magistrate of Kalinagar circle, Hari Om Sharma, but he declined.
